I just heard the first Pīpīwharauroa (Shining Cuckoo) in the garden this morning, while feeding the chickens. These little guys fly all the way from places like The Solomons and PNG to spend their Summers here in NZ, so their song is a definite sign that Spring has arrived! Despite today's weather 🤣

Pīpīwharauroa lay eggs in the nest of riroriro (grey warblers). The baby cuckoo ejects the host nestlings, and, mimicking the call of a grey warbler chick, demands food from its obliging ‘foster’ parents! Brutal, but even with this parasitic challenge warbler populations are plentiful and thriving. While not currently threatened, cuckoo numbers are declining.

A relatively small cuckoo with iridescent dark green plumage upperparts and white below with narrow dark green transverse bands. Immature plumage is slightly duller, especially on the throat and chest, with less distinct ventral barring.
